As we go through each of these areas, we realize there are many inconsistencies in religion, no religion is infallible, that religious stories about our origins are allegories, and rules made centuries ago must be revised to reflect our current world. 

   ( Paragraph 23 Trans Error: Unknown )

·       Many people believe that we get our values from god, or at least from religion.  We show in Part 1 that there is no reason to believe in God (Chapter 1.3 on Theology).  Even if there were a god, we also show that we still need to obtain our values independently of God – otherwise we would never know whether God was good or bad (Chapter 1.5 on Ethics).

   ( Paragraph 24 Trans Error: Unknown )
  • Many religious stories can be inspiring, regardless of their scientific or historical validity.  Religion emphasises the value of narrative, as a means to provide meaning and direction, from the brief moments of the Muslim Hadith, the parables of Jesus, majestic Hindu tales such as the Ramayana, to the grand narrative each religion has covering the creation of the world, humanity’s fall from grace, the path to redemption, and perhaps the end of the world.
  • But religion does provides a wealth of ways to explore and express our values and our connection to the world, and we can benefit from this without becoming irrational.  We need to work out which aspects of religion promote our core values of truth, diversity, reality, life, love, responsibility, equality, beauty and hope, and discard those aspects that don’t.
